Tottenham Hotspur 'put £30m price tag on Pierre-Emile Hojbjerg'

Tottenham Hotspur are reportedly putting a price tag of £30m on midfielder Pierre-Emile Hojbjerg, with former boss Jose Mourinho likely to want Hojbjerg at new club Roma.

Tottenham Hotspur have reportedly put a £30m price tag on midfielder Pierre-Emile Hojbjerg, who only arrived in North London last summer.

Spurs purchased Hojbjerg from Southampton for £15m in August and Daniel Levy is believed to be accepting of the proposal to sell the Danish international, but only for a significant profit.

Hojbjerg has played in every minute of Spurs' Premier League campaign in his debut season for the club and has managed to find the back of the net twice, also providing four assists for his teammates this season.

According to Football Insider, former manager Jose Mourinho will be coming to the table with an offer from Roma for the Lilywhites' midfielder, with the Portuguese a big admirer of the central midfielder.

It is reported that Tottenham will have lost around £150m in revenue after this season without fans coming through the turnstiles, and it is suggested that the club are going to sell players to make up the funds.

Hojbjerg's potential last game for Tottenham could be at the King Power Stadium against Leicester City on Sunday.
